Amels was first established as a family boat-building business by founder Kees Amels. Located in a small yard in Makkum, northern Holland, the Amels yard went on to deliver around 100 vessels during the first half of the 20thcentury, specializing in wooden fishing boats and steel tugboats up to 65 feet (20m) in length. The second half of the 20thcentury saw Kees son, Wiebe Amels, move the yard with the view to building larger commercial vessels and coasters. The yard, which was located on the outside of the Ijssellake-dike on the Makkumerwaard, went on to become one of Holland’s largest shipyards. Seeing the private yacht sector taking shape during the late 1970s, Wiebe went on to diversify Amels’ shipbuilding skills to specialize in the build of high-value luxury yachts. In 1982 Amels launched the 158-foot (48m) motor yacht KATALINA, and the next decade saw several notable luxury yachts coming from the Amels yard. [links]
